Rare isn't the word I would use to decribe them - Suzuki kept them in production from 1985 until 1993 - there are thousands of them out there. There are actually two different models of these quads the LT230E/S Quadrunner and the LT250S Quadsport - the model line was split in 1989 and the 250 model was dropped in 1991. The LT250S was a little larger in its dimensions, had a little longer wheel travel, different swingarm, plastics, seat etc.

The LT230 does have alot of power for a 230. Hardley - The 230 motor is only rated at 11hp, which is one less than the first generation 200X motor - which is smaller in displacement. The 250 motor only had 12hp, which is quite anemic considering its immediate competition, Hondas 250X, had 15.6hp. I had a blue and white '89 Q-Sport for a little while. Even with a DG RCM on her and a K&N jet kit installed, it could barely hang with 300EX's as I recall. About the only thing it had going for it over a 300EX was the fact that it was a bit lighter.
